About Social Circle Elementary School
Social Circle Elementary School is a regular public elementary school located in the rural setting of Social Circle, Georgia. The school serves students from third to fifth grade and has an enrollment of 423 students with a student-teacher ratio of 15.1:1. There are 28 full-time equivalent teachers dedicated to providing quality education.
Social Circle Elementary School's MySchoolScout rating is 6.3 out of 10, placing it at the 63rd percentile among all schools in Georgia. In terms of academic performance, 44% of students are proficient or above in English Language Arts and Reading, while 46% meet proficiency standards in math. The school focuses on student development with room for further academic growth.

Funding & Resources
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 47% (2019) to 43.9% (2024). Reading/ELA proficiency has improved from 41% (2019) to 45.1% (2024).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Social Circle Elementary School has a median household income of $91,125. It is an area where 26%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$275,300, with a median rent of $1,108/month. The local poverty rate of 3.7%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 33 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
